The amount of any claim made pursuant to this chapter by a claimant from a household consisting solely of one person shall be determined as follows:

(1) If the claimant’s income is eight thousand nine hundred forty-nine dollars or less, a sum of two hundred fifty-eight dollars;

(2) If the claimant’s income is eight thousand nine hundred fifty and not more than fourteen thousand nine hundred forty-nine dollars, a sum of forty-six dollars plus three and four-tenths percent of the difference between fourteen thousand nine hundred forty-nine dollars and the income of the claimant; and

(3) If the claimant’s income is more than fourteen thousand nine hundred forty-nine dollars, no refund.
